- [What are the MC03’s charging and battery capabilities? Does it support wireless charging? Is it replaceable?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/what-are-the-mc03%E2%80%99s-charging-and-battery-capabilities-does-it-support-wireless-charging-is-it-replaceable-6856173.md): The MC03 features a 5200 mAh removable Li-Po battery. It supports 30W wired charging with PD 3.0 and 15W wireless charging. The battery is user-replaceable and can be accessed by removing five screws.
- [What type of battery does the MC03 use, and how long does it last?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/what-type-of-battery-does-the-mc03-use-and-how-long-does-it-last-6856174.md): The MC03 uses a rechargeable lithium-polymer battery. It is designed to support more than 1,000 charge cycles while maintaining at least 80% of its nominal capacity, helping ensure long-term reliability and performance.

- [Does the MC03 support video output via USB-C, e.g. connecting to an external monitor?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/does-the-mc03-support-video-output-via-usb-c-eg-connecting-to-an-external-monitor-6856188.md): No. The MC03 does not support video output via USB-C. The feature required for this functionality, DisplayPort Alt Mode, or DP Alt Mode, is not supported by the device’s chipset. As a result, it is not possible to connect the MC03 directly to an exte

- [What is the difference between Vault and Wild Web on the MC03?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/what-is-the-difference-between-vault-and-wild-web-on-the-mc03-6855570.md): Vault is the MC03’s secure, minimal home space. It includes trusted apps curated by Punkt., designed to offer a private and distraction-free experience. In Vault, your data remains fully under your control, with no third-party tracking or profiling.

- [How do you ensure long-term security updates given limited SoC vendor support?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/how-do-you-ensure-long-term-security-updates-given-limited-soc-vendor-support-6888285.md): The MC03 is designed to provide at least 5 years of security updates and 3 years of functional, or feature, updates, in line with evolving EU guidelines. Our objective is to maintain a high level of device security and reliability throughout its life
- [Will the MC03 be updated to newer Android versions?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/will-the-mc03-be-updated-to-newer-android-versions-6888288.md): The MC03 ships with Android 15, and an upgrade to Android 16 is planned. Based on the current roadmap, this update is expected in Q3 2026 and will bring additional privacy and security enhancements.
- [Will the MC03 receive updates beyond the announced support period?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/will-the-mc03-receive-updates-beyond-the-announced-support-period-6888315.md): The MC03 is guaranteed to receive at least 5 years of security updates and 3 years of functional, or feature, updates, in line with the EU Ecodesign regulation. These timeframes represent our official commitment and what we can reliably guarantee. Wh

- [Why isn’t my MP01 working on 2G networks?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/why-isn%E2%80%99t-my-mp01-working-on-2g-networks-2041901.md): The MP01 works only on 2G networks. Many countries are shutting down 2G, so if 2G is no longer available where you live, the MP01 won’t connect. Check here if 2G is still active in your area.

- [What does DECT mean?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/what-does-dect-mean-2032841.md): DECT stands for Digital Enhanced Cordless Telecommunications. It is a wireless standard that is often used for landline phones. DECT is advantageous for cordless phones because it has a long-range both indoors and outdoors and a frequency that doesn'
- [What is the difference between the DP01 and the DP01s?](https://support.punkt.ch/en-US/what-is-the-difference-between-the-dp01-and-the-dp01s-2032842.md): The DP01 is the main unit, which means it comes with a base station that connects to a phone socket and power source; it functions as the master unit and can connect up to 5 additional handsets. The DP01s comes without a base station and can be used
